What is the function of the Human Rights Secretariat in Argentina?
The Secretariat of Human Rights in Argentina is the body in charge of promoting and protecting human rights in the country. Its main function is to investigate and document human rights violations, provide assistance to victims and promote memory, truth and justice in relation to the crimes committed during the last military dictatorship.

What is the difference between judicial records and police records in Argentina?
Judicial records refer to convictions and judicial actions, while police records include information recorded by security forces, such as arrests and procedures.

What measures have been taken to strengthen regulatory compliance in the environmental field in Costa Rica?
Costa Rica has established solid environmental laws, such as the Organic Law of the Environment, that seek to guarantee the sustainable use of natural resources. The National Environmental Technical Secretariat (SETENA) supervises the environmental impact assessment, contributing to regulatory compliance and sustainable development in the country.
